Grammar Playsheets
The following grammar skills playsheets are provided free to homeschoolers and homeschooling parents and were created to inspire and captivate students who are able to choose what, when and how to study.
Note: These are exercises used in classroom and online courses. See the Abacus-es Classes page. Many contain intentional errors to be fixed. Be sure to look up vocabulary terms as needed.
